Goal(s)

Learning outcomes :

  • To understand the probabilistic concept of the real random variable
  • To conduct a statistical study in its entirety, from the modelling phase, through parameter estimation, to the implementation of hypothesis tests
  • To know the probabilistic vocabulary, real random variables, usual laws to present the statistical approach as a whole (histograms, probability graphs, parametric estimation, confidence intervals, hypothesis tests, linear regression)
  • To have the statistical tools to perform descriptive statistical analyses and inferential statistical analyses

Content(s)

After a first part on probability (vocabulary, random variables, common laws of probability), the statistical approach is presented in its entirety (histograms, statistical plots, point estimation, confidence intervals, testing statistical hypotheses, linear regression).
If all the tools described in the paper support provided are not being treated in class, this course should enable the students to use them if needed in their professionnal life.
Understanding the concept of random variable in order to be able to make a statistical study in its entirety, from the modeling phase, through the estimation of parameters, and to testing statistical hypotheses.
